cargo ship ARIZONA

Compagnie Générale Transatlantique, 1928 - 1942

cargo ship Arizona
Design features
Arizona (steel cargo ship) 1928 - 1942
hull material : ...................steel
previous name(s) of ship : ........
detailed type : ...................steel cargo ship
type of propulsion : ..............1 propeller
building year of ship : ...........1925
name of shipyard : ................Sunderland Ship.
place of construction : ...........Sunderland
year of entering the fleet : ......1928
length (in meters) : ..............133,34
width (in meters) : ...............16,66
gross tonnage (in tons) : .........5457
deadweight (in tons) : ............8849
type of engine : ..................inverted, triple expansion 3 cylinders
engine power (in HP) : ............3300
nominal speed (in Knots) : ........11
History
Cargo liner of 8900t, 3rd unit of the series ARICA. Built in Great Britain in 1925 for Harlem S.S. Compagny, English subsidiary company of CGT, and chartered by this one at her time of the delivery. Bought by the CGT from her subsidiary Company and put under the French Flag on October 12, 1928. Laid up in Marseille in 1940, then given to Germany on December 1 1942 following the Laval-Kaufmann agreements. Entrusted to Italy, renamed CHIETI, placed under the control of the Company Adriatica. Sunk by bombardment on April 2, 1943 in Palermo. Reset a float on October 28, 1946, intended to be given in condition for handing over to France, but lost on December 13, 1947 during her towing from Tarente towards a Shipyard in North of Italy.
